HTML & CSS Combo Essentials 2 Days Overview
This 2-day Essentials course will cover everything you need to get started with producing HTML and styling your content with CSS. You will learn how web pages are structured under the hood and how you can put together your own files for the web. We will also show you how to use CSS to control every aspect of a site's visuals: its fonts, colours, leading, margins, and more.
Upon successful completion of this course, you will be able to:
- Understand the syntax and structure of HTML pages
- Insert tags, attributes, and values into a page
- Define titles, headings, and page regions
- Add links, alternate text content, and background images
- Position and resize images and other page elements
- Work with colours
- Use correct styles instead of deprecated HTML tags
- Design without relying on tables
- Include padding, margins, borders, and backgrounds
- Write selectors to target only specific parts of a page
- Produce horizontal and vertical navigation bars
- Style hyperlinks
- Differentiate between external, embedded, and inline styles
Our goals are for you to understand how to create and adjust your own HTML documents, and for you to understand how to enhance the visual appearance of your web pages.
